Addiction Treatment Strategies (ATS) provides a six-month intensive outpatient medical detoxification stabilization and addiction treatment program located in Edwardsville, IL. The practice is a therapeutically based, medically assisted program that offers an integrated approach to treating addiction. ATS provides cognitive behavioral therapy groups, individual therapy, group psycho-educational sessions, group psychotherapy, and family orientation and support. The program is designed as an alternative to AA self-help groups, using a combination of CBT, individual therapy, and family education to influence life changes. ATS employs medications to treat underlying problems and brings about stability necessary for behavioral change. The practice teaches patients conceptual and contextual learning strategies through their own unparalleled approach to CBT, with an emphasis on structure, organization, and discipline through monitoring sleep, exercise, and diet as key clinical indicators of improvement.
